Case in point: PEFTA alumnus Ken Samudio who is quickly bubbling up in the international style consciousness. His calendar is booked with trips to Milan and Paris for, well, Fashion Week—no big deal.
Kidding aside, the designer is on a roll—and we couldn’t be more proud of him. So as he boards that plane today to continue with his worldwide wardrobe domination, we’re making closet space for his Fall/Winter 2015 collection entitled, Amalgamy.
“It’s my first stint at styling. I wanted the models to be as lifeless as possible… No emotions and slightly on the frail side to give the look book a haunting feel,” Ken reveals.
The collection is inspired by oil spills. “If you notice, the shades are muted by the seemingly flowing black color.”
Ken is a marine biologist by profession. (What?! No fashion background needed to make it into Vogue?) This passion for the ocean life extends to his collections. “I try to tell a story through my collections.”
Each product took about two weeks to finish. Everything is hand-embroidered one piece at a time.
These beauties are available at Thecorner.com, Harvey Nichols London, Barneys New York and soon at LuisaViaRoma.com.
